When considering sun shade nets, one of the primary factors influencing price is material quality. Typically, sun shade nets are made from polyethylene, which is renowned for its durability and resistance to environmental stressors like UV radiation and rain. However, premium nets embedded with UV-stabilized materials can be pricier due to their extended lifespan and superior protective properties. Investing in a higher-grade polyethylene net can be cost-effective in the long run, as it reduces replacement frequency and maintenance costs.
The size of the sun shade net is another determinant that cannot be overlooked. Larger nets naturally require more material and time to fabricate, driving up the overall price. Therefore, it is important to consider the specific measurements of the area you wish to cover to determine the exact size you need. It is often advisable to consult with a professional to ensure precise measurements, as purchasing an overly large net can result in unnecessary expenses.

UV protection levels also play a significant role in the pricing of sun shade nets. These products are designed to block a certain percentage of UV rays, which can range from 30% to 90% or more. Higher UV protection percentages generally equate to higher net costs, yet the benefits of safeguarding people and property from harmful UV exposure should not be underestimated. Selecting a UV protection level suitable for your climate and intended use ensures optimal performance and value for money.
